I think matches are so hard. I'm sitting here wearing a beautiful 3 stone ring from the 20's, the sides are about 3.5 mm, and they don't match perfectly. There's a colour difference so I can always tell if my ring is right side up or not. It doesn't bother me, but I do notice it. I also bought tons of stones about 5 yrs ago to make a matched set for earrings. My earrings match, nearly perfection. Dreamer, I think you'd approve! I can tell them apart with a loupe because of the crowns, but that's it. It took me nearly a year of buying every 1/3 carat out there to find a match. I sold all the others, not finding them suitable enough for me, and now wish I'd kept one pair which someone else bought as a match.

I agree, these stones aren't perfection, but even in rings from the time period the crowns are often pretty different. More and more I'm starting to think I'm too picky and have re-sold perfectly good stones that no one else can see the difference in.

I bought a pair of antiques (my old OEC studs, now the first pair of sides in my mother's five stone) from mlopros some time ago. Mike refused to call them a "match", though he did say that they looked good together - the distinction Tgal highlights. I am quite picky as well, especially about facet patterning, and IMO they most definitely merit the "matched pair" description. At that point mlopros was quite popular on PS so if there was an adjustment period (and I assume there was, how could there not be?) I missed it.
